Our premium line up consists of a smooth body with a piggy back reservoir. We're still playing with valving and nitrogen psi and offering this shock as an upgrade from 2 per corner to 1. The piggy back is very clean but it limits some placement options. As of right now the front shocks (12") work with our 3.5"+2" body lift using our stage 2 shock hoops. The rear (9")work with the same lift configuration using our stage 2 rear shock mounts. We had to turn the piggyback 90 degrees from front to rear due to our front and rear shock mounts are not orientated the same way. That is the limiting factor as of right now. We could run a remote resi and we might go back to that option so we're not limited but it's just not as clean as the piggy back.

I gotta post pics of our adjustable track bar, I think it's the nicest, cleanest built track bar on the market. Fully tig welded, all the ends are machine finished and every piece of DOM that our bushings slip into are turned down on a lathe. Then it's sent to powder coat for a clean black finish. I know some guys want a heim on the frame end, it's on my list as an option to make however a heim is not street legal in every state so we started by playing it safe. I recently had a customer ask me to custom build a track bar with a heim on both ends. The cost is about double though. Most broncos do great with our track bar just the way it is
